    Nav disc unreadable- losing my mind.

    Guest-only advertisement. Register or Log In now!
    Hi everyone.
    Starting to look for any solution to this issue.

    Bought an 07 s4 avant.
    Have this current version of the Nav DVD that doesn't work.


    Then I bought a new DVD from AudiNav.
    To update to the most current maps. 2015

    Inserted the CD. Did some buzzing.
    And came to this error





    Then asked me to reinsert my original DVD

    And went back to this screen.
    Still doesn't work.
    I'm not sure what to do or how to solve.
    But it's killing me.

    So I replaced the whole disc drive.
    Was pretty easy.
    Here are some pics.

    Couple of screws here. Couple there.
    Got the drive for $150 shipped.
    Works as good as new!!
    Uploaded to new 2015 maps also
